2 IB World SchoolLCL is proud to be an authorized IB World School. “ The In-ternational Baccalaureate® (IB) is a non-profit educational foundation, motivated by its mission, focused on the student.

Our four programmes for students aged 3 to 19 help develop the intellectual, personal, emotional and social skills to live, learn and work in a rapidly globalizing world.

Founded in 1968, we currently work with 3,805 schools in 147 countries to develop and offer four challenging programmes to over 1,190,000 students aged 3 to 19 years. “ www.ibo.org

To become an authorized IB World School, LCL had to un-dergo two years of self-evaluation, reflections and modifica-tions at all levels.

3 Our Academic Programmes LCL offers two programmes for students aged 15 and above. Both of our programmes are complementary and taught in English.

Preparatory Class (PC) caters for students who are looking to learn or improve their English language skills, Mathemat-ics reasoning, Sciences lab experiments, Human Sciences, while maintaining the balance between academic and social aspects. The PC is a one-year programme that leads to the IBDP.

International Baccalaureate - Diploma Programme (IBDP) “ is an academically challenging and balanced pro-gramme of education with final examinations that prepares students for success at university and life beyond. It has been designed to address the intellectual, social, emotional and physical well-being of students. The programme has gained recognition and respect from the world’s leading universi-ties. ” www.ibo.org

4 A Gateway to the WorldThe International Baccalaureate Diploma is a worldwide rec-ognized diploma. Students receiving their diploma can apply to any university of their choice. In 2013, almost 100,000 IB students went on to postsecondary studies, and this num-ber rises annually. In the last 10 years, IB students have sent transcripts to well over 5,000 higher education institutions in more than 100 countries, and a growing body of research provides evidence that IB students are more likely than their peers to go on to higher education and perform better once there.
